Direct comparison of every spec from each device profile.
| Specification | DaVinci MIQRO | RiO |
|---|---|---|
| Price (USD) | $99 | $150 |
| Device Type | — | Portable |
| Heating Type | Conduction | Conduction |
| Heat Up Time | ~40 seconds | — |
| Temperature Range | 170°C - 230°C | N/A |
| Chamber Capacity | ~0.3g | N/A |
| Battery Type | Removable 18350 battery | N/A |
| Battery Capacity | 900mAh | — |
| Battery Life | ~20-30 minutes | — |
| Charging | Micro USB | N/A |
| Charge Time | ~2 hours | — |
| Dimensions | 79x34x23mm | — |
| Height | — | 14 inches |
| Weight | 104g | ~522g |
| Power Adjustment | Digital Control | Manual |
| Chamber Material | Ceramic | Glass |
| Concentrate Support | — | Yes |
| Brand | DaVinci Tech | Stache |
| Adjustable Airflow | No | — |
| Release Date | 2018 | — |
| Warranty | 5 years | 1 year |
The biggest practical difference is portability: the DaVinci MIQRO is roughly 418g lighter than the RiO, which adds up over a day of pocket carry.
DaVinci MIQRO is the cheaper option at $99 compared with $150 for the RiO, about $51 less. Live retailer pricing can shift, so confirm before buying.
DaVinci MIQRO is the lighter unit at 104g, around 418g less than the RiO at ~522g. The lighter device is easier to carry and pocket day-to-day.
DaVinci MIQRO uses removable 18350 battery, so you can carry spares for back-to-back days. The RiO has a built-in battery you can't swap on the go.
DaVinci MIQRO controls heat with digital control, while the RiO uses manual. DaVinci MIQRO gives you finer per-degree control.
